The Youth Employment Agency (YEA) and the National Ambulance Service (NAS) are set for a strategic partnership in the training and deployment of 6,000 community medical first responders across the country.
During the ceremony held at the YEA headquarters in Accra, acting YEA Chief Executive Officer, Malik Basintale, announced that, the initiative aligns core mandate of creating job opportunities for young Ghanaians while supporting NAS in enhancing the country’s emergency response system. It is expected to not only provide employment but also save lives, as prompt first aid can significantly improve survival rates in critical situations.
Mr. Basintale also credited former NAS CEO, Dr. Ahmed Nuhu Zakariah, for playing a key role in bringing the initiative to fruition.
Speaking at the event, the acting CEO of NAS, Dr. George Kojo Owusu, stressed the importance of the partnership, noting that it comes at a time when the service requires additional manpower to improve emergency response times.
This initiative is part of efforts to strengthen emergency healthcare delivery at the grassroots level.
This collaborative will equip the youth to undergo intensive medical emergency response training under the guidance of the NAS. Once trained, these CMFRs will be strategically deployed in underserved communities to provide immediate care in emergencies before professional medical teams arrive.
Note About The Training
The training programme will feature 10 modules, including Introduction to Emergency Medical Services, Airway Management and Breathing, Circulation and Bleeding Control, and Mass Casualty Incidents and Triage.
Instructional methods will combine classroom lectures, simulation-based learning, practical exercises, case studies, role-plays, and scenario drills to ensure trainees are fully prepared for real-life emergencies.
